2011-01-06 6 views
1

私はWPF形式のDataGridを持っています。WPFツールキットDataGrid SelectionChangedセル値を設定する

ここでは、特定のセルのセル値を設定したいとします(この場合の日付の形式を修正してください)。 DataGridはItemsSourceに接続されています。

Cel Valueを取得するには、次のようないくつかの方法があります。 - Cell.Content.Textの設定をGetCell(TextBlockにキャストした後)。 - またはItemsSource:data.Rows [j] .ItemArray.GetValue(i).ToString();

今、私はセルのテキスト内容を設定したい(私は、データグリッド、列の最後の行/項目番号がある)。

値の設定方法は?それはdatagrid direcltyに現れなければなりません。

ありがとう、Leo!

答えて

1

セルにバインディングを使用してデータを設定した場合は、カスタムコンバータを使用して自動的にフォーマットすることができます。

コードビハインドからデータグリッドにアクセスしていますか?もしそうなら、それは本当に乱雑になるだろう。 MVVMパターンへの移行を検討することを強く推奨します。

関連する問題